CI note — Fernhollow greenhouse controller. Nightly calibration job keeps failing because the humidity sensor fixture drifts after 40 minutes of soak testing. Workaround: re-zero the mock sensor in the setup stage and pin the thermal model to v3. If the drift check still trips, attach the failing run's trace token below.

pipeline stamp: htk31_f769b577b3028a4e9958e5bb8d1259a

### Onboarding: Thumbcache Leak Workstream

New folks joining the Thumbcache memory-leak effort: the leak lives in the Pindrop image cache's eviction path. Fix builds go out through the Osselton hotfix channel, which requires signed artifacts. Ask in the weekly sync for verifier access. Builds must be signed with the team's hotfix key, which is:

rollout seal: bky9_aBG1gvAyU

Subject: Recon job hardening — review requested

The Glimmerhatch inventory reconciliation job now runs with a scoped service account and writes only to the audit ledger. Network egress is blocked except to the warehouse mirror. No secrets in env vars; all pulled at runtime from the vault sidecar. Diff is small. The signed artifact for this release is identified by the token below.

pipeline stamp: htk9_6ce9d33c5